About the name ADOLINE
Adoline, a name imbued with grace and charm, is a melodic variant of the classic name Adeline, which has roots in the French and German languages, deriving from the Old High German word "adel," meaning "noble." This name evokes a sense of dignity and refinement, resonating with a rich history that spans across cultures.
